Excerpt from If Only For One Night by Victoria Christopher Murray and ReShonda Tate Billingsley
Blu Logan
There were three reasons why I couldn ’ t jump up and give myself a high-five the way I wanted to over those one-hundred-and-forty points I just scored . First , I was already in bed , second , I was lying butt-naked in the dark , and third …
“ Ugh ! Will you get off that game ?”
And reason number three : I was in my bed , butt-naked … next to my wife .
“ Please ,” Monica whined .
The end of my lips turned down just a little , but I wasn ’ t going to let Monica steal my joy . Because Lord knows , she wasn ’ t the one who ’ d given it to me . All of this joy that filled me right now was because of DivineDiva . Damn , she was a challenge .
“ That light is too much .”
And then , there was the woman next to me who didn ’ t challenge me at all . Although , Monica had once — six years ago .
I turned my attention back to the game , so wanting to stay in this place . It wasn ’ t often that I got a chance to one-up DivineDiva . Two weeks , and I hadn ’ t beaten her once . But this move right here , it had been calculated , it had been strategic , and there wasn ’ t anything that she could do .
“ Did you hear what I said ?” Monica said .
Monica was that thief in the night . Because all of my joy — stolen ! “ How is the light from my phone bothering you ?”
She pushed herself up in the bed , and leaned back on her elbows . The light from the television was what made the room so bright and I easily saw her glare .
She said , “ You have a six-plus . That thing is dang-near the size of an iPad . And I ’ m trying to sleep .” Then , she sat up and adjusted the pink hair roller that was falling into her face .
